Which is better PS Vita Slim or fat?

The PS Vita Fat uses an OLED display. However, in the Slim version, the console received a lower cost LCD screen. At the same time, the resolution and physical screen sizes are the same in both versions. The main difference lies in the colouring.

Why did PS Vita fail?

Since the PS Vita was such a beefy handheld console with high-quality specs, making games for the system was difficult, time-consuming, and expensive. But the PS Vita wasn't selling well. And since it was so expensive and difficult to make games for, many third-party developers just didn't.

What's the difference between the PS Vita models?

The PS Vita Slim has roughly the same proportions as the original PS Vita when seen face-on (85.1 x 183.6mm to 83.5 x 182mm) but is obviously thinner - although only by 3mm. The PS Vita Slim is 15mm thick, while the PS Vita is 18mm. It weighs a bit less at 219g to the original's 260g.

Which PS Vita models are OLED?

The first Vita has an OLED screen, the Vita Slim an LCD screen. This has helped lower the cost of making the handheld console, letting Sony be a bit more aggressive with its pricing. However, it's not really an upgrade. The resolution – predictably – hasn't changed from the original 950 x 540 pixels.
